IA apprendre JavaScript : guide complet pour développeur débutant 2026
Découvrez comment l'IA apprendre JavaScript devient simple grâce à Copilot et ChatGPT. Ce guide 2026 vous initie au code assisté, sans stress.
Dans un monde où la programmation évolue à la vitesse de l’intelligence artificielle, IA apprendre JavaScript n’est plus une option, mais une nécessité stratégique pour tout développeur débutant. En 2026, maîtriser JavaScript avec l’aide de l’IA, c’est acquérir un avantage compétitif décisif, tant sur le plan technique que juridique. Ce guide vous offre une feuille de route complète, validée par des experts et conforme aux dernières réglementations.
L’IA apprendre JavaScript ne se limite pas à copier du code : elle implique une compréhension fine des bonnes pratiques, de la propriété intellectuelle et de la responsabilité. Que vous utilisiez Copilot, ChatGPT ou des plateformes no-code, chaque ligne générée soulève des questions juridiques que nous allons décortiquer ensemble. Préparez-vous à transformer votre apprentissage en un atout légal et technique.
Ce guide est conçu pour les débutants qui souhaitent IA apprendre JavaScript de manière efficace, éthique et sécurisée. Nous aborderons les fondamentaux, les outils d’IA, les pièges à éviter, et surtout, comment coder sans risquer de litige. Bienvenue dans votre nouveau parcours de développeur augmenté.
Points clés couverts dans ce guide
- Les bases de JavaScript assisté par IA (Copilot, ChatGPT, Codeium)
- Stratégies d’apprentissage avec l’IA pour les débutants en 2026
- Bonnes pratiques de refactoring et de sécurité avec l’IA
- Aspects juridiques : droit d’auteur, licence, responsabilité du code généré
- Intégration de l’IA dans le no-code et les workflows professionnels
- Exercices pratiques et cas d’usage concrets
- Jurisprudence 2026 : premières décisions sur le code généré par IA
- Recommandations pour un apprentissage conforme et performant
Pourquoi l’IA est votre meilleur professeur de JavaScript en 2026
L’IA apprendre JavaScript transforme la courbe d’apprentissage traditionnelle. Fini les heures perdues sur des erreurs de syntaxe : l’IA vous propose des corrections en temps réel, des explications contextuelles et des exemples adaptés à votre niveau. En 2026, les modèles comme GPT-5 et Copilot X sont capables de générer du code fonctionnel en JavaScript tout en expliquant chaque étape.
« En tant qu’avocat spécialisé, je considère que l’IA est un outil pédagogique puissant, à condition que le développeur conserve un contrôle humain sur le code produit. La jurisprudence de 2026 (Civ. 1ère, 12 mars 2026, n°25-10.543) rappelle que l’auteur du code reste responsable de son contenu, même généré par IA. »
L’IA apprendre JavaScript permet aussi de personnaliser votre rythme. Besoin de revoir les bases des tableaux ? L’IA génère des mini-exercices. Prêt pour des algorithmes ? Elle vous challenge avec des problèmes de type LeetCode, mais avec des explications pas à pas. C’est un tuteur disponible 24/7, sans jugement.
Les outils d’IA essentiels pour apprendre JavaScript
Pour IA apprendre JavaScript, vous devez choisir les bons outils. Voici les incontournables de 2026, avec leurs forces et leurs limites juridiques.
2.1 GitHub Copilot (version 2026)
Copilot X est intégré à VS Code et propose des suggestions contextuelles. Il excelle pour le code répétitif et les fonctions utilitaires. Attention : le code généré peut être soumis à des licences open source (jurisprudence Copilot, CA Paris, 8 février 2026, n°25/01234).
2.2 ChatGPT (GPT-5) et alternatives
ChatGPT reste le meilleur pour l’apprentissage conceptuel. Vous pouvez lui demander : « Génère un quiz sur les opérateurs JavaScript » ou « Corrige mon code et explique chaque erreur ». En 2026, la version payante offre une mémoire persistante de votre progression.
2.3 Plateformes no-code/low-code avec IA
Des outils comme Bubble, Adalo ou Retool intègrent désormais des assistants JavaScript. Idéal pour les débutants qui veulent voir le code derrière l’interface. L’IA y génère des scripts personnalisés sans écrire une ligne.
« L’utilisation d’outils no-code ne vous exonère pas de la responsabilité du produit final. La directive européenne 2025/987 sur l’IA impose une transparence sur l’origine du code. Conservez toujours l’historique des prompts utilisés. »
Méthodologie d’apprentissage : du prompt au code propre
Pour IA apprendre JavaScript efficacement, suivez cette méthodologie en 5 étapes, validée par des formateurs et des avocats.
Étape 1 : Définir un objectif clair
Exemple : « Je veux créer une todo list interactive en JavaScript pur. » Plus votre prompt est précis, meilleure est la réponse de l’IA.
Étape 2 : Demander une explication avant le code
Prompt : « Explique-moi le concept d’événement en JavaScript avec un exemple simple. » L’IA vous donne la théorie, puis le code.
Étape 3 : Générer le code et le comprendre
Demandez : « Génère le code HTML/CSS/JS pour une todo list. Ajoute des commentaires pour chaque ligne. » Analysez chaque commentaire.
Étape 4 : Modifier et expérimenter
Prenez le code généré et modifiez-le volontairement. Observez les erreurs. L’IA peut les corriger et expliquer pourquoi cela ne marchait pas.
Étape 5 : Tester et valider légalement
Avant d’utiliser le code dans un projet, vérifiez qu’il n’enfreint pas de licence. Utilisez des outils comme FOSSA ou Snyk pour détecter des snippets protégés.
« La Cour de justice de l’UE (CJUE, 3 juin 2026, aff. C-456/25) a jugé que le code généré par IA peut être protégé par le droit d’auteur si l’humain apporte une contribution créative suffisante. Documentez vos modifications ! »
Refactoring et débogage assisté par IA
L’IA apprendre JavaScript ne s’arrête pas à l’écriture de code. Le refactoring est une compétence clé pour un développeur débutant. En 2026, l’IA peut analyser votre code et proposer des améliorations structurelles, de performance et de sécurité.
4.1 Refactoring automatique avec l’IA
Utilisez des prompts comme : « Refactore ce code pour utiliser les fonctions fléchées et const/let » ou « Transforme cette boucle for en méthode .map() ». L’IA vous montre les deux versions et explique les avantages.
4.2 Débogage intelligent
Copiez votre code avec l’erreur et demandez : « Pourquoi cette fonction retourne undefined ? » L’IA identifie les bugs courants (scope, hoisting, références). Elle peut même simuler l’exécution pas à pas.
4.3 Sécurité du code
L’IA peut détecter des failles XSS ou des injections SQL dans votre code JavaScript. Exemple : « Analyse ce formulaire pour des vulnérabilités de sécurité. » C’est un premier filtre, mais ne remplace pas un audit humain.
« La responsabilité du développeur est engagée en cas de faille de sécurité, même si le code a été généré par IA (Cass. com., 22 avril 2026, n°25-14.789). Un refactoring régulier avec l’IA est une obligation de moyen. »
No-code, low-code et JavaScript : le rôle de l’IA
Pour IA apprendre JavaScript, le no-code est une porte d’entrée paradoxale mais efficace. En 2026, les plateformes no-code génèrent du JavaScript sous le capot. Comprendre ce code vous rend plus autonome.
5.1 Comment l’IA traduit le visuel en code
Des outils comme Webflow ou Wix Studio utilisent l’IA pour convertir des actions visuelles en fonctions JavaScript. En tant que débutant, vous pouvez inspecter le code généré et demander à ChatGPT de vous l’expliquer.
5.2 Hybride : no-code + scripts personnalisés
Ajoutez des blocs de code JavaScript personnalisés dans vos applications no-code. L’IA vous aide à écrire ces scripts, par exemple : « Écris une fonction qui envoie un email après soumission d’un formulaire dans Bubble. »
5.3 Limites juridiques du no-code
Le code généré par une plateforme no-code appartient souvent à la plateforme (lisez les CGU). Pour un projet professionnel, préférez exporter le code et le modifier avec l’IA.
« Dans un litige récent (TGI Paris, 15 janvier 2026, n°25/00123), un développeur no-code a perdu la propriété de son application car le code source était hébergé exclusivement sur le serveur de la plateforme. L’IA ne remplace pas la lecture des conditions contractuelles. »
Aspects juridiques et conformité pour le développeur débutant
L’IA apprendre JavaScript implique une dimension légale souvent négligée. Voici les textes applicables et les décisions de 2026 qui vous concernent.
Textes applicables
- Loi n°2025-112 du 15 mars 2025 relative à l’intelligence artificielle et à la propriété intellectuelle (article L. 112-7 CPI modifié)
- Règlement européen 2024/1689 (IA Act) – articles 28 et 29 sur la transparence des systèmes d’IA générative
- Directive 2025/987 sur la responsabilité du fait des algorithmes (transposée en droit français par ordonnance du 10 janvier 2026)
- Code de la propriété intellectuelle – articles L. 111-1, L. 121-1 et L. 131-3 (droits d’auteur sur le code)
- Jurisprudence : Cass. civ. 1ère, 12 mars 2026, n°25-10.543 (responsabilité du développeur utilisant une IA) ; CJUE, 3 juin 2026, aff. C-456/25 (protection du code généré par IA) ; TGI Paris, 15 janvier 2026, n°25/00123 (propriété du code no-code)
6.1 Droits d’auteur sur le code généré
En 2026, la loi française reconnaît que le code généré par IA peut être protégé si l’humain apporte une contribution créative (modifications, choix structurels). Conservez les prompts et les versions modifiées.
6.2 Licence et réutilisation
Le code généré par Copilot peut contenir des extraits sous licence MIT, GPL ou Apache. Vérifiez avec des outils de scan. L’IA Act impose de mentionner l’utilisation d’IA dans vos projets.
6.3 Responsabilité civile et pénale
Vous êtes responsable du code que vous déployez, même s’il a été généré par IA. Une faille de sécurité peut engager votre responsabilité contractuelle et délictuelle. La jurisprudence 2026 est claire : l’IA est un outil, pas un bouclier.
« Ne considérez jamais l’IA comme un co-auteur. Vous seul êtes responsable. La Cour de cassation (22 avril 2026) a condamné un développeur qui avait délégué son obligation de vérification à l’IA. »
Cas pratiques et exercices guidés par l’IA
Pour IA apprendre JavaScript, rien ne vaut la pratique. Voici 3 exercices concrets à réaliser avec l’IA, avec des conseils juridiques intégrés.
Exercice 1 : Créer une calculatrice en JavaScript
Prompt : « Génère une calculatrice simple avec HTML, CSS et JavaScript. Ajoute des commentaires expliquant chaque fonction. » Après génération, demandez : « Ajoute une gestion d’erreur pour la division par zéro. »
Exercice 2 : API fetch avec gestion d’erreurs
Prompt : « Écris une fonction asynchrone qui récupère des données depuis une API publique et affiche les résultats. Explique le try/catch. » Modifiez ensuite l’URL pour tester différentes réponses.
Exercice 3 : Validation de formulaire côté client
Prompt : « Crée un formulaire de contact avec validation JavaScript (email, téléphone). Ajoute des messages d’erreur personnalisés. » Vérifiez que le code ne stocke pas de données sensibles.
« Pour chaque exercice, je recommande d’ajouter un fichier LICENSE.txt dans votre dossier de projet, même pour un apprentissage. Cela vous habitue aux bonnes pratiques. La jurisprudence 2026 valorise la traçabilité. »
Perspectives 2026 : IA, JavaScript et éthique du code
L’IA apprendre JavaScript en 2026, c’est aussi intégrer une dimension éthique. Les IA génératives peuvent reproduire des biais ou des vulnérabilités. En tant que développeur débutant, vous devez apprendre à détecter ces biais.
8.1 Biais dans le code généré
Exemple : une IA pourrait générer un algorithme de tri qui désavantage certaines données. Testez toujours votre code avec des jeux de données variés.
8.2 Transparence et explicabilité
L’IA Act exige que les systèmes d’IA soient explicables. Pour votre code, cela signifie commenter, documenter et justifier vos choix. L’IA peut vous aider à rédiger une documentation claire.
8.3 Vers un code durable et accessible
L’IA peut optimiser votre code pour réduire la consommation énergétique (exemple : éviter les boucles inutiles). C’est une compétence valorisée en 2026.
« L’éthique du code devient une exigence légale. La loi n°2025-112 prévoit des sanctions pour les algorithmes discriminatoires. L’IA apprendre JavaScript doit inclure une formation aux biais algorithmiques. »
Points essentiels à retenir
- IA apprendre JavaScript est une méthode puissante mais encadrée juridiquement.
- Conservez toujours les prompts et les versions modifiées pour prouver votre apport créatif.
- Scannez les licences du code généré pour éviter les violations de droits d’auteur.
- La responsabilité du code vous incombe, même avec l’IA.
- Utilisez l’IA pour le refactoring, le débogage et la documentation, mais validez humainement.
- Le no-code n’est pas un refuge juridique : lisez les CGU et exportez votre code.
- Formez-vous aux biais et à l’éthique pour un code responsable.
- En 2026, la jurisprudence est en faveur du développeur qui documente son travail.
Foire aux questions (FAQ)
Q1 : Puis-je utiliser ChatGPT pour apprendre JavaScript sans risque juridique ?
Oui, pour un usage personnel et éducatif, le risque est faible. Pour un usage commercial, conservez les prompts et vérifiez les licences. La jurisprudence 2026 encourage la transparence.
Q2 : Le code généré par Copilot est-il protégé par le droit d’auteur ?
Oui, si vous apportez des modifications substantielles. La CJUE (3 juin 2026) a reconnu la protection du code modifié par l’humain. Documentez vos changements.
Q3 : Dois-je mentionner que j’ai utilisé l’IA dans mon code ?
L’IA Act (art. 28) impose une mention de transparence pour les systèmes d’IA générative. Ajoutez un commentaire en tête de fichier : « Code partiellement généré par IA (Copilot/ChatGPT) ».
Q4 : Puis-je être poursuivi si mon code généré par IA contient une faille de sécurité ?
Oui. La responsabilité du développeur est engagée (Cass. com., 22 avril 2026). L’IA est un outil, pas une excuse. Faites auditer votre code.
Q5 : Les plateformes no-code peuvent-elles revendiquer la propriété de mon code JavaScript ?
Oui, si les CGU le stipulent. Lisez attentivement les conditions. TGI Paris (15 janvier 2026) a donné raison à une plateforme. Exportez et modifiez le code.
Q6 : Comment débuter avec l’IA pour apprendre JavaScript en 2026 ?
Choisissez un outil (ChatGPT ou Copilot), définissez un objectif simple, et demandez des explications avant le code. Suivez la méthodologie en 5 étapes de ce guide.
Q7 : Existe-t-il des certifications pour l’apprentissage du JavaScript avec l’IA ?
Oui, des formations comme « IA-Augmented Developer » (2026) commencent à émerger. Vérifiez qu’elles incluent un module juridique.
Q8 : Que faire si mon code généré par IA ressemble à un code protégé ?
Utilisez un outil de détection de similarité (ex : Codequiry). Si un risque est détecté, modifiez la structure et les commentaires. En cas de doute, consultez un avocat.
Notre recommandation
L’IA apprendre JavaScript est une révolution pour les développeurs débutants, à condition de rester maître de votre code. En 2026, la clé est l’équilibre entre productivité et conformité juridique. Suivez les bonnes pratiques de ce guide, documentez votre travail, et n’hésitez pas à vous former en continu.
Pour aller plus loin, consultez Iaprogramme — IAProgramme.fr, votre ressource dédiée à la programmation assistée par IA. Nous proposons des tutoriels, des analyses juridiques et des outils pour les développeurs de tous niveaux.
Verdict : Adoptez l’IA comme un assistant, pas comme un substitut. Votre créativité et votre vigilance restent vos meilleurs atouts.
Sources et références
- Loi n°2025-112 du 15 mars 2025 relative à l’IA et à la propriété intellectuelle (JORF n°0064)
- Règlement (UE) 2024/1689 du Parlement européen et du Conseil (IA Act)
- Directive 2025/987 du Conseil du 12 décembre 2025 sur la responsabilité algorithmique
- Cass. civ. 1ère, 12 mars 2026, n°25-10.543 (responsabilité du développeur)
- CJUE, 3 juin 2026, aff. C-456/25 (protection du code généré par IA)
- TGI Paris, 15 janvier 2026, n°25/00123 (propriété du code no-code)
- Cass. com., 22 avril 2026, n°25-14.789 (obligation de vérification)
- Code de la propriété intellectuelle – articles L.111-1 à L.131-3
- Documentation OpenAI – ChatGPT et GitHub Copilot (2026)
- Guide OWASP pour la sécurité du code JavaScript (2026)